@vercel/next
Advanced tools
Comparing version 2.6.27 to 2.6.28-canary.0
@@ -6,3 +6,3 @@ "use strict"; |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
exports.getSourceFilePathFromPage = exports.isDynamicRoute = exports.normalizePage = exports.syncEnvVars = exports.getRoutes = exports.getPathsInside = exports.getNextConfig = exports.normalizePackageJson = exports.excludeLockFiles = exports.validateEntrypoint = exports.excludeFiles = exports.getPrerenderManifest = exports.getExportStatus = exports.getExportIntent = exports.createLambdaFromPseudoLayers = exports.createPseudoLayer = exports.ExperimentalTraceVersion = exports.getDynamicRoutes = exports.getRoutesManifest = void 0; | ||
exports.getSourceFilePathFromPage = exports.isDynamicRoute = exports.normalizePage = exports.syncEnvVars = exports.getRoutes = exports.getPathsInside = exports.getNextConfig = exports.normalizePackageJson = exports.excludeLockFiles = exports.validateEntrypoint = exports.excludeFiles = exports.getPrerenderManifest = exports.getExportStatus = exports.getExportIntent = exports.createLambdaFromPseudoLayers = exports.createPseudoLayer = exports.ExperimentalTraceVersion = exports.getImagesManifest = exports.getDynamicRoutes = exports.getRoutesManifest = void 0; | ||
const async_sema_1 = require("async-sema"); | ||
@@ -365,2 +365,16 @@ const buffer_crc32_1 = __importDefault(require("buffer-crc32")); | ||
exports.getDynamicRoutes = getDynamicRoutes; | ||
async function getImagesManifest(entryPath, outputDirectory) { | ||
const pathImagesManifest = path_1.default.join(entryPath, outputDirectory, 'images-manifest.json'); | ||
const hasImagesManifest = await fs_extra_1.default | ||
.access(pathImagesManifest) | ||
.then(() => true) | ||
.catch(() => false); | ||
if (!hasImagesManifest) { | ||
return undefined; | ||
} | ||
// eslint-disable-next-line @typescript-eslint/no-var-requires | ||
const imagesManifest = require(pathImagesManifest); | ||
return imagesManifest; | ||
} | ||
exports.getImagesManifest = getImagesManifest; | ||
function syncEnvVars(base, removeEnv, addEnv) { | ||
@@ -367,0 +381,0 @@ // Remove any env vars from `removeEnv` |
{ | ||
"name": "@vercel/next", | ||
"version": "2.6.27", | ||
"version": "2.6.28-canary.0", | ||
"license": "MIT", | ||
@@ -43,3 +43,3 @@ "main": "./dist/index", | ||
}, | ||
"gitHead": "c5d04e0d4f37c5466bfc0e8ba1529ae23028acb0" | ||
"gitHead": "2e957fce550897711425e3a24caa75c827a277bf" | ||
} |
Sorry, the diff of this file is too big to display
Sorry, the diff of this file is too big to display
Dynamic require
Supply chain riskDynamic require can indicate the package is performing dangerous or unsafe dynamic code execution.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
1463623
40205
1
36